之前在网上看到一个帖子,说是要使用shell模拟密码输入功能。平常使用sudo命令时,就会有输入密码提示,shell会屏蔽掉所有的键盘输入(不显示“*”,什么都不显示★_★)。之后查阅各种资料,找到了两种比较简单的实现方法。1、read -sread读取用户的输入并将其存入指定的变量中。指定-s选项后,输入将不回显。于是实现代码如下:#!/bin/bash
echo -n "Username:
转载
2024-01-03 12:57:22
110阅读
# Java脚本模拟按键实现指南
## 简介
本文将指导你如何使用Java脚本来模拟按键操作。模拟按键可以用于自动化测试、按键精灵等场景,帮助你提高工作效率。在本指南中,我将逐步介绍整个实现过程,并提供相关代码和注释。
## 实现流程
下面是整个实现过程的流程图:
```mermaid
erDiagram
开始 --> 按键模拟初始化
按键模拟初始化 --> 模拟按键
原创
2024-01-03 09:21:41
48阅读
键盘是最常用的输入设备,通过键盘可以将汉字、英文字母、数字、标点符号等输入到计算机中,从而向计算机发出命令、输入数据。那么键盘分为几个功能区?各键的功能是什么呢?组合键又有什么功能呢?下面就分别予以说明 (以win10 OS 、联想台式机键盘等为例)。一、键盘分区一般的标准键盘分为功能区、主键盘区、控制键区和数字键区。 二、键盘各键功能 1.功能键区 ESC:取
转载
2024-08-18 09:53:07
317阅读
# 如何通过 Shell 模拟 Android 按键事件
在移动开发中,特别是 Android 应用的自动化测试或者脚本操作中,有时候需要模拟用户的按键事件。通过 Shell 命令可以非常方便地实现这一操作。本文将带你一步一步了解如何使用 Shell 来模拟 Android 按键事件。
## 整体流程
以下是实现模拟按键事件的整体流程:
| 步骤 | 描述
# Android shell模拟物理按键
在Android开发中,有时候我们需要模拟物理按键的操作,例如模拟点击返回键、Home键等。Android提供了一个能够在命令行中模拟按键操作的工具——`input`。
## input命令简介
`input`命令是Android系统中的一个工具,用于模拟按键事件。通过使用不同的参数,我们可以模拟按下、弹起、滑动等不同类型的按键事件。
下面是`i
原创
2023-07-27 21:23:18
919阅读
1.#!脚本的开头
#!/bin/bash2.脚本属性
添加可执行属性,chmod +x 或使用“.”运行,例如运行当前目录下的a.sh 可执行命令 “. ./a.sh”
文件格式要是unix,在linux下创建的文件没有问题,在windows下写的脚本要特别注意文件格式
查看文件格式 vim 打开文件
set ff 查看文件格式
set ff=type 设置文件格式,type为文件格式3.变量
转载
2023-12-01 19:35:36
77阅读
Shell程序设计作为一种脚本语言,在Linux系统中有广泛的应用,本文记录了关于Shell程序设计的基础语法知识、管道、输入输出重定向和一些常用命令,方便查询,熟练使用shell也需要经常实践,这对于完成一些较简单的编程任务很有帮助。
1、Shell简介 作为Linux灵感来源的Unix系统最初是没有图形化界面的,所有的任务都是通过命令行来实现的。因
转载
2023-10-19 23:22:08
78阅读
本来是想介绍一些具体的代码,但是这些代码只适合我玩的这款游戏,对大家没什么帮助。不过就此停笔,又好像太突然了。那就介绍一些思路供大家参考。如何在action中确保只打开某个窗口 比如在“自动挂机检物”action中,只需要打开“包袱窗口”;在游戏过程,很多窗口被打开过,可能关了,也可能没关。要是一个一个判断窗口存在就关闭太麻烦;我的做法是:单击“ESC”键,不管三七二十一,关闭全部窗口;然后
转载
2024-04-10 13:03:56
36阅读
本项目使用arduino对python进行了键盘映射,可以实现python传按键信息给开发板,开发板输入真实键盘信息到电脑中。应用场景:现在市面上的养成类PC电脑游戏中玩家都会需要脚本来解决一些复杂繁琐的事情,例如:角色打怪练级,完成每日任务,跑图等等。而现如今的游戏都有针对模拟按键脚本的检测机制,普通的模拟按键脚本根本无法绕过检测机制运行,而真实键盘的按键信息可以完美的解决容易被游戏系统检测的问
转载
2024-06-12 16:14:57
601阅读
android中通过sendevent模拟按键
原创
2023-09-13 08:49:46
364阅读
如何用最快最有效的方式进行测试? 很多开发的习惯是,二话不说,写完/拿到,就跑一把,看看输入,输出,想要的操作是否完成,也就过了。其实这是十分不严谨的,若是未经过QA,风险还是相当大的。 以下即shell脚本测试流程,仅供参考1.代码走读: 通读代码,确保明白代码的实现和自己预设的一致。 读什么? A
转载
2023-12-01 11:28:45
43阅读
shell中的文本处理1、grep--文本过滤命令全面搜索研究正则表达式并显示出来;grep命令是一种强大的文本搜索工具,根据用户指定的“模式”对目标文本进行匹配检查,打印匹配到的行;由正则表达式或者字符及基本文件字符所编写的过滤条件[root@localhost ~]# cp /etc/passwd /mnt/
[root@localhost ~]# cd /mnt/
[root@localho
需求在 A 界面,点击跳转到 B 界面(该界面会执行一些业务),再点击返回键出现 Dialog 弹窗,点击确认退出按钮,返回 A 界面。不断循环。思路一开始想到的就是按键精灵,下了 mac 版使用后发现功能太不完善,于是试了试 Windows 版,实在是操作不习惯。在搜索资料过程中了解到还可以使用 adb 来实现模拟设备操作,那肯定是写代码更顺手啊,配合使用脚本重复输入命令,就能实现简单的自动化重
转载
2023-10-23 21:56:08
387阅读
按键精灵安卓版是安卓平台的按键与触摸操作的操作录制软件,类似电脑上的按键精灵,它能够录制用户的动作,并在播放时按下一个热键,就可以完全模拟用户录制时的所有操作,如同有个无形的手帮你按键。按键精灵安卓版能帮助您完成所有重复的按键操作!在刷帖和玩游戏的时候很有用。按键精灵安卓版之软件特色:1.录制用户触摸动作2.支持脚本编辑功能3.支持全屏找图,区域找图,模糊找图4.支持全屏找色,区域找色,模糊找色5
转载
2023-10-29 14:42:59
57阅读
# iOS Shell脚本模拟点击的实现指南
在iOS开发的过程中,我们有时需要通过脚本自动化一些操作,例如模拟点击。这不仅能提高工作效率,还能帮助我们进行重复性测试。在这篇文章里,我们将详细介绍如何用shell脚本来模拟点击操作,并为你提供一个完整的实现流程。
## 流程概述
在开始之前,我们需要了解整个实现的流程。下面是一个简单的流程图:
```mermaid
flowchart TD
转载
2017-02-17 10:52:00
268阅读
2评论
An application can simulate a press of the PRINTSCREEN key in order to obtain a screen snapshot and save it to th parameter set to VK_SNAPSHOT,
原创
2015-09-16 11:46:09
134阅读
Python不以性能见长,但掌握一些技巧,也可尽量提高程序性能,避免不必要的资源浪费。1、 使用局部变量尽量使用局部变量代替全局变量:便于维护,提高性能并节省内存。使用局部变量替换模块名字空间中的变量,例如 ls = os.linesep。一方面可以提高程序性能,局部变量查找速度更快;另一方面可用简短标识符替代冗长的模块变量,提高可读性。2、 减少函数调用次数对象类型判断时,采
转载
2023-08-23 21:32:43
496阅读
1 文件{
ls -rtl # 按时间倒叙列出所有目录和文件 ll -rt
touch file # 创建空白文件
rm -rf 目录名 # 不提示删除非空目录(-r:递归删除 -f强制)
dos2unix # windows文本转linux文本
unix2dos # linux文本转windows文本
enca filename # 查看编码 安装 yum install -y en
转载
2024-08-06 11:49:32
126阅读
#! /bin/bashfor i in ‘seq $1’doecho -ne "i=0;while truedoi=i+1;done" | /bin/sh &done上述脚本保存为可执行的sh文件,例如eatcpu.sh,需要吃几个cpu的核就在脚本的后面添加数字几,例如 ./eatcpu.sh 4
原创
2015-04-06 21:59:45
1853阅读